Released on , OutKast’s sophomore album, ATLiens , stands as a monumental shift in hip-hop history. Following their debut, André 3000 and Big Boi evolved from "two dope boyz" into visionary artists, crafting a sound that effectively put the South on the map during an era dominated by bicoastal rivalries.
